The Lenovo ThinkPad P16 Gen 2 is a mobile workstation designed for professionals like designers, developers, and creators who need powerful performance on the go. It offers blazing-fast memory, high-performance storage, and a stunning display, ensuring a smooth workflow. However, it's worth noting that its high-performance capabilities come at a higher price point compared to standard laptops.

FAQs

How do I update the drivers?

You can update the drivers through the Device Manager in Windows or use the Lenovo Vantage application.

What is the warranty period?

The ThinkPad P16 Gen 2 typically comes with a standard one-year warranty. Check your specific model's warranty details.

How do I access the BIOS?

Press the F2 key during startup (before Windows loads) to enter the BIOS settings.

Can I upgrade the RAM?

Yes, the ThinkPad P16 Gen 2 supports RAM upgrades. However, confirm the maximum supported RAM for your specific configuration.

How do I clean the laptop?

Use a soft, damp cloth to clean the exterior. Avoid using harsh chemicals or excessive moisture. Use compressed air to clean the keyboard and vents.

Does the laptop have a webcam?

Yes, it has a Full HD webcam with a privacy shutter and human presence detection.

What is the battery life like?

Battery life varies based on usage, but users can expect several hours of use depending on the tasks being performed.

Troubleshooting

Laptop won't turn on.

Check the power adapter connection and outlet. If the device still won't turn on, try holding the power button for 15-20 seconds to reset the system.

Poor performance.

Close unnecessary applications. Run a virus scan. Ensure the latest drivers and Windows updates are installed. Check the system’s resource usage and ensure adequate storage space is available.

Wi-Fi connectivity issues.

Ensure Wi-Fi is enabled. Check your internet connection. Restart your router and laptop. Update the Wi-Fi drivers if needed.

Display issues (flickering, distorted image).

Ensure the display drivers are up to date. Try connecting an external monitor to determine if the issue is with the laptop's display. Adjust the display resolution and refresh rate in the settings.

Keyboard not responding.

Restart the laptop. Check the keyboard drivers. Ensure that the keyboard is not disabled in the BIOS. Try connecting an external keyboard to isolate the issue.

Pros and Cons

Pros

  • High-performance Intel Core i7 processor for demanding workloads.
  • Stunning Quad HD+ display with a 165Hz refresh rate for a premium visual experience.
  • NVIDIA RTX 2000 Ada graphics for professional-grade graphics performance.
  • Generous 1 TB SSD storage for fast access to files and applications.
  • Comprehensive security features including fingerprint reader and ThinkShield.
  • Durable design, MIL-SPEC certified for reliability.

Cons

  • Higher price point compared to standard laptops.
  • Weight of 2.95 kg may be heavy for some users.
  • Battery life may be shorter under heavy workloads.
  • May require optional accessories like a stylus pen.
  • Can generate significant heat under sustained heavy use.
